📘 Mini-Lesson of the day: [Zugzwang]

Today’s theme is about Zugzwang in chess

💡 Key Insights:

  • You create a situation where whatever the opponent moves, your opponent would lose some material

Let us see an example to understand this

White to play and Win

White starts with Re4, attacking the bishop. Now, wherever the black moves, the black would lose his bishop

Variation 1: Bg3/bf2 The king can capture the bishop

Variation 2: Be1 Re1 captures the rook

Variation 3: Kf5/Kg6/Kf6 the rook will capture the bishop
